Reasons Your LinkedIn Network Isn't Growing

If your network seems stuck, there’s likely a pattern behind it. LinkedIn rewards the kind of activity that sparks connection, not just ticking boxes. When content stays flat and connections stall, it's usually one of these areas that needs adjusting.

1. Inconsistent activity

Posting once every few weeks won’t do much. If you disappear for long periods, it's easy for people to forget you. Even if your content is valuable, it needs to show up often enough to stay top of mind. People trust profiles that are active and visible. A steady rhythm of posting, even just two or three times a week, can create steady momentum.

2. Lack of engagement

Spending time only on your own content is a missed opportunity. LinkedIn is about interaction, not just broadcasting messages. If you're not commenting on other posts, sharing insights in ongoing conversations, or replying to comments, you're sitting on the sidelines. A lot of growth happens through conversations that don’t start on your profile.

3. Unclear profile

Your profile is like your shop window. If it’s messy, vague, or blank, people won’t stop to look closer. An unclear headline, missing photo, or generic summary suggests you aren’t active or serious. That’s enough reason for some people to skip the connect button. On the flip side, a strong profile with a professional photo and a sentence or two explaining what you do instantly builds trust.

4. Irrelevant content

Even if you’re showing up often, what you post matters. If your content isn’t speaking to the people you want to attract, it’s not going to grow your network. For example, if you're a marketing consultant but most of your posts are general life advice, you may be missing the mark. That doesn’t mean you have to post stiff or overly formal content, but it should reflect your area of focus.

Strategies To Boost Your LinkedIn Network

If you’re clear on what’s been slowing your LinkedIn growth, the next step is to flip the approach. Building connections isn’t about chasing numbers. It’s about being visible, adding value, and making people want to connect with you. Instead of guessing what works, try adding a few practical strategies into your regular LinkedIn routine.

Here are some things that make a real difference:

- Post regularly: Set a simple target, like two or three posts every week. Don’t overthink it. Share a useful insight, answer a question you’ve been asked recently, or comment on something happening in your industry. Keep it clear and relatable.

- Comment with intent: Forget the one-word comments. Take the time to respond properly to other people's content. Add your own view, ask a follow-up question, or agree with explanation. When people see you often and associate you with thoughtful replies, connections grow naturally.

- Update your profile: Give people a reason to connect. Add a recent photo, write a punchy headline, and use the summary to say what you do in a clear, human voice. Keep it conversational but informative. If it feels like a cold CV, they’ll likely click away.

- Use platform tools wisely: Features like hashtags, LinkedIn Groups, live sessions, and newsletter publishing are free ways to get seen. Hashtags help your content reach outside your current network. Groups and live posts allow space for proper back-and-forth conversations that matter.

Imagine someone scrolling through LinkedIn at lunch and seeing your comment on a post they already follow. If that comment stands out, they’re far more likely to check your profile, read your recent content, and then send a connection request. That’s how things shift, and it always starts from interaction rather than just uploading another post and hoping for the best.
